Overview

POINT REYES STATION is an operational landfill in Point Reyes Station, California, USA. It serves the Marin County area under US EPA RCRA Subtitle D regulations.

POINT REYES STATION is an operational landfill located in Point Reyes Station, California, within Marin County. As a solid waste management facility in the United States, it operates under the regulatory framework of the US EPA, including RCRA Subtitle D for municipal solid waste landfills and Clean Air Act landfill gas rules. The facility is classified under NAICS code 562212 for solid waste landfills. Landfills in California are subject to stringent state and federal regulations, including requirements for liner systems, leachate collection, and groundwater monitoring. The facility likely manages waste from the surrounding communities, with typical landfill operations involving waste compaction, daily cover, and gas management. California's regulatory environment emphasizes methane capture and emission reductions, aligning with state climate goals. The landfill plays a key role in waste disposal for the Point Reyes Station area, supporting local sanitation needs. Its location in a coastal region of California necessitates careful environmental management to protect groundwater and nearby ecosystems. Environmental context

The landfill is situated in a coastal region of California, near the Point Reyes National Seashore, an ecologically sensitive area. Key environmental considerations include landfill gas management to mitigate methane emissions, leachate control to prevent groundwater contamination, and proximity to natural habitats. California's strict landfill regulations require comprehensive monitoring and mitigation measures to address these risks.
